The Anthem Pro Levers from PSR are the most adjustable, feature packed lever in the PSR line! These levers go beyond the standard reach adjustment, offering a length customization from Standard to Shorty, ensuring your controls are always right where you need them, reducing fatigue and reaction time!
The Anthem Pros come equipped with a spring-loaded hinge and a foldable lever blade that effectively reduce the risk of damage in a crash, great for track riders, agility masters and newbies alike!

‼️MPORTANT/READ:
Due to OEM thicker tolerance on some lever mounts, ‘22+ touring models may need slight thinning to avoid being too tight.
Other Info:
Users are to exercise proper judgment to determine optimal performance. If the lever is too close, it will run out of cable play and won’t fully disengage. It should not be adjusted all the way in. Check the clutch cable to have minimal play. If there is too much free play, it would not have enough cable travel for clutch disengagement.
